In 1674, Susanna Holbrook entered the world in Medfield, Norfolk, Massachusetts Bay, British Colonial America, born to Thomas Holbrook And Margaret Bouker. Susanna Holbrook married Daniel Morse, and had children including Obadiah Morse. Susanna Holbrook passed away in 1717 in Sherborn, Middlesex, Massachusetts Bay, British Colonial America.
